Output 95b1e0d3d9409ea5a1f2c83200879a9289fc4fa6847033c23e8c1ec5a4fba593:0

value
26197638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bf092fe9ee441688d1de29f5dbf7c8ed1525d00 OP_EQUAL
address
379wzFTQX6fYpi5LzYeaUtHRihh1orhsWU
transaction
95b1e0d3d9409ea5a1f2c83200879a9289fc4fa6847033c23e8c1ec5a4fba593
spent
true